Read and learn:
Some Party Crashers ("Mini-Qs," "Q-turds") have hit point bars, some do not.
The Party Crashers with hit point bars will run.Every time. Bar none.
The Party Crashers without hit point bars spawn the shell game.Every time. Bar none.
Pick the ones you want- it only takes a tiny little bit of paying attention and thinking.
